Frantic is a 1988 American - French neo-noir [2] mystery thriller film directed by Roman Polanski and starring Harrison Ford and Emmanuelle Seigner. Ennio Morricone composed the film score.

Prominent American surgeon Dr. Richard Walker travels to a medical conference in Paris with his wife, Sondra. The first time they went to Paris was for their honeymoon and now they intend to celebrate the return to there. In their hotel room, Richard realizes that Sondra brought a wrong suitcase.
Overview. The wife of an American doctor suddenly vanishes in Paris and, to find her, he navigates a puzzling web of language, locale, laissez-faire cops, triplicate-form filling bureaucrats and a defiant, mysterious waif who knows more than she tells. Roman Polanski.
